Job Duties

  • Meet with patient and/or patient’s caregiver to exchange necessary information and documentation
  • provide explanation of visit, instructions, and address concerns and questions
  • verify insurance benefits and obtain pre-certification/authorization as necessary
  • escort and transport patients and visitors within facility, which may include a wheelchair or oxygen tank
  • determine and accept required payments, including co-pays and deductibles, or refer to financial counselors for follow up
  • ensure that all necessary demographic, billing, and clinical information is obtained and entered in the registration system with timeliness and accuracy
  • use critical thinking skills, decisive judgment, and work with minimal supervision in a fast-paced environment
